Griffins take two out three from Blackburn
The Fontbonne University men's baseball team won their second straight conference series taking two out three from Blackburn College this weekend. The Griffins improved to 8-13 overall and 4-2 in the St. Louis Intercollegiate Athletic Conference (SLIAC).
On Saturday, in the first game of the doubleheader, senior Sean Fischer went 3-4 with three RBI's and a run scored to power Fontbonne to a 7-1 win. Junior Jacob Becker three a complete game to earn the victory. Becker allowed only one run while striking out four and walking just one. Freshman Jesse Schott went 2-4 from the plate while blasting his first collegiate home run.
In the nightcap, Fontbonne gave up five runs over the final two innings to fall to Blackburn 8-5. Fischer was 3-3 with a run scored and a RBI.
On Sunday, the Griffins broke open a close game by scoring five runs in the top of the eighth inning to cruise past Blackburn 9-3. Senior Matt Suda, Fischer and freshman Jason Klein had two RBI's apiece. Junior Jack Celesie picked up the win for Fontbonne going 2.2 innings in relief allowing no runs while giving up just four hits.
